Convert the following angle from degrees to radians. Express your answer in simplest form. 435^

Respuesta :

cwrw238 cwrw238
  • 24-03-2021

Answer:

29π/12.

Step-by-step explanation:

Multiply by π/180

= 435π/180

= 29π/12 radians.
